When zeolite, a hydrated sodium aluminium silicate, is used with hard water, which ions from the water replace the sodium ions in the zeolite?

  1. H⁺ ions
  2. Ca²⁺ ions
  3. SO₄²⁻ ions
  4. OH⁻ ions

Correct answer: Ca²⁺ ions

Solution

Zeolite acts as an ion exchange material, where the sodium ions are replaced by calcium ions from hard water, effectively softening the water by removing hardness-causing minerals.
